#138581 Hex color

#138581

The hexadecimal color code #138581 corresponds to the code RGB( 19, 133, 129 ). It's a shade of Green. This color is a combination of red (at 0,07 level), green (at 0,52 level) and blue (at 0,51 level). Its brightness is 29% and its saturation is 75%. It is composed of red at 6%, green at 47% and blue at 45%.
